Output 2af11373962ae25b6bf43ffc29062b645bb36d70866fa41cddc73f9468d59012:5

value
33369882
script pubkey
OP_0 OP_PUSHBYTES_32 edaf913c0637498bcbc048b816b894e2df03e408260ada106b7ab4e2e5db51e7
address
ltc1qakhez0qxxaychj7qfzupdwy5ut0s8eqgyc9d5yrt026w9ewm28nst2y4mx
transaction
2af11373962ae25b6bf43ffc29062b645bb36d70866fa41cddc73f9468d59012
spent
true